Everyone who offers goods and services must charge VAT to their clients and then transfer this sum to the Finanzamt, including freelancers. The Finanzamt will use this to calculate the amount of tax you have to pay in your quarterly pre-payments. When you register your business at the Finanzamt, you have to give an estimate of how much you think you will earn.
